Dovercourt

I rarely hear people refer to this neighbourhood as Wallace Emerson, or even Wallace Emerson Dovercourt Junction.  Most people know this as Dovercourt, or Dovercourt Junction.  This neighbourhood is a mix of residential and industrial and homes here are modestly sized and are a mix of detached and semi-detached brick homes. 

The residents here are a cultural mix of different backgrounds who are known to include Portuguese, Italian and English. A large Ethiopian population is also present in the area. There are many shops along Bloor Street serving the Portuguese and Ethiopian communities.
